PROBLEM TO BE SOLVED: To provide a technique that can reduce an overall electric power consumption of multiple cooling devices as much as possible by simple calculation.SOLUTION: A demand control apparatus 10 generates such a constraint condition that the corrected entire cold heat loads (L-ΔQ) obtained by subtracting a necessary capacity inhibiting amountΔQ from the sum L of cold heat loads corresponding to the driving capability to be output by multiple cooling devices 2-k in the future, respectively, is equal to a total value of the values obtained by multiplying the driving capability Qof the multiple cooling devices 2-k by a driving state value uindicating those driving/stopping state, respectively. Then, the demand control apparatus 10 calculates the driving capability Qof the multiple cooling devices 2-k and the driving state value uto minimize the total value of the values obtained by multiplying the electric power consumption Wof the multiple cooling devices 2-k by those driving state values u, respectively, under the constraint condition. |
